Engineering Technician

KBR is seeking a skilled Engineering Technicians to support
hands-on testing, inspections, troubleshooting, and technical operations for C-130J and C-130H aircraft systems, including avionics, propulsion, and propeller assemblies (54H60, NP2000, R391). This role works directly with engineers to support system evaluations, modifications, and sustainment activities.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Perform inspections, testing, troubleshooting, and equipment setup on C-130J/H avionics, propulsion, and propeller systems
    Support data collection, technical documentation, and engineering evaluations for T56, AE2100, and propeller systems
  • Assist with system installations, prototype builds, wiring harness fabrication, and configuration updates
  • Conduct hands-on work with propeller systems, including blade tracking, vibration checks, and control-system troubleshooting
    Maintain tools, test equipment, and work environments in accordance with safety and quality standards
  • Support engineering teams during ground tests, functional checks, and system validations
    Interpret technical orders, wiring diagrams, schematics, and engineering drawings


Qualifications:

  • Technical degree or equivalent military/industry experience
  • Experience with C-130J/H avionics, propulsion, or propeller systems
  • Ability to read and interpret technical orders, wiring diagrams, and engineering documentation
